Liraglutide vs. Semaglutide A Comparative Overview
In recent years, the landscape of diabetes treatment has evolved significantly, particularly with the introduction of glucagon-like peptide-1 (GLP-1) receptor agonists. Two of the most prominent medications in this category are liraglutide and semaglutide. Both are designed to help manage type 2 diabetes, but they differ in their mechanisms, efficacy, side effects, and administration methods. Understanding these differences can help patients and healthcare providers make informed decisions about their diabetes management strategies.
Mechanism of Action
Both liraglutide and semaglutide function as GLP-1 receptor agonists. GLP-1 is a hormone that stimulates insulin secretion in response to meals, inhibits glucagon release, slows gastric emptying, and promotes satiety. By mimicking this hormone, both drugs help regulate blood glucose levels effectively. However, semaglutide is a newer medication that has been engineered to have a longer half-life than liraglutide, leading to more sustained effects in glucose regulation.
Efficacy
Clinical trials have shown that both liraglutide and semaglutide are effective in lowering HbA1c levels—a key marker of long-term blood glucose control. However, semaglutide has consistently demonstrated superior results compared to liraglutide. In studies, semaglutide has been found to reduce HbA1c levels by approximately 1.5% to 2% compared to liraglutide’s average reduction of around 1% to 1.5%. Additionally, semaglutide has been associated with greater weight loss, making it a preferred option for overweight individuals with type 2 diabetes.
Dosage and Administration
Liraglutide is typically administered as a daily subcutaneous injection, while semaglutide can be administered as a weekly injection. This difference in dosing frequency can greatly influence patient compliance. Many patients may find it easier to adhere to a weekly injection schedule, which is a significant advantage of semaglutide. For patients who struggle with daily injections, semaglutide’s longer duration of action can reduce the burden of treatment.
Side Effects
Both medications share common side effects, including gastrointestinal issues such as nausea, vomiting, diarrhea, and abdominal pain. However, these side effects tend to diminish over time as the body adjusts to the medication. Notably, semaglutide may have a slightly higher incidence of gastrointestinal side effects, particularly during the initial weeks of treatment, compared to liraglutide.
Both drugs also carry a warning regarding pancreatitis, as well as potential risks for thyroid tumors based on animal studies. Therefore, regular monitoring and discussions with healthcare providers regarding any concerning symptoms are essential.
Cardiovascular Outcomes
Another key aspect of the comparison between liraglutide and semaglutide is their impact on cardiovascular health. Both medications have been associated with favorable cardiovascular outcomes, which is particularly important for patients with type 2 diabetes who are at increased risk of cardiovascular events. Semaglutide’s efficacy in reducing major cardiovascular events has been demonstrated in large cardiovascular outcome trials, showing a clear benefit for patients with pre-existing cardiovascular conditions.
